Coral Springs Skilled Nursing Facility in Wilmington, DE is looking for an experienced Dietary Director to oversee the dietary department.
The Manager is able to perform and often performs the job assignments of the dietary aide, cook, and dishwasher positions and is able to operate a variety of industrial kitchen equipment.
The Manager performs and leads small groups of assistants in food preparation, serving and clean-up activities on varying shifts as needed. The Food Service Director assumes the responsibility of managing and supervising the dietary staff at a single site according to policies and procedures, and federal/state requirements.
Provides leadership, support, and guidance to ensure that food quality standards, inventory levels, food safety guidelines and customer service expectations are met.

Certificates
Food Safety Manager or Food handler Certification: Current ServSafe or State certification required as indicated by State / County law.
CDM / CFPP: Current Certified Dietary Manager (CDM)/Certified Food Protection Professional (CFPP) required where participant or certification is required by State regulation for long-term care.
